WebIn KS1 maths, Year 2 children who are working at greater depth can: Read scales where not all numbers on the scale are given, and estimate points in between. Recall and use multiplication and division facts for 2, 5 and 10 and make deductions outside known multiplication facts (e.g. 2x2 is the same as 1x4). LA External Moderation; Exemplification Materials ; STA Guidance ; Assessment Grids; STA Reading Videos ; Phonics Screening Check Autumn Term 2024; English Secondary; Early Career Framework; Equalities; Islington SACRE; … pacific led gen4 wt470c led80sWebIf you are trying to evidence those readers at Greater Depth, allow them to choose a book of their own choice. Ask them questions about why they chose it and why they enjoy reading it.
